Europe Advances in ‍Vacuum Vessel Development for ITER

Significant Progress in the Fusion ‍Energy Project

The⁤ European team involved in the International Thermonuclear Experimental Reactor (ITER) has successfully achieved another milestone by completing ⁤a crucial segment of the vacuum‌ vessel. The‍ construction of⁢ this component⁣ is ‍vital for initiating⁣ full-scale nuclear fusion experiments,⁢ paving the way for cleaner ‌and sustainable energy‌ solutions.

What Makes⁣ the Vacuum ​Vessel Essential?

The vacuum vessel serves as⁣ the backbone of ITER’s fusion experiment,​ containing the high-temperature plasma that ‍mimics conditions found within stars. With an aim to replicate sustained nuclear⁢ fusion—the process​ that powers our sun—this vacuum structure is designed to withstand extreme temperatures⁢ and pressures inherent in scientific experimentation related to fusion energy.

Collaborative Efforts Across Borders

This phase of ⁢construction⁣ has highlighted exceptional collaboration between various European countries, showcasing a⁣ unified dedication ‌towards advancing renewable energy technologies. Countries ⁣such as⁢ France, Spain,‌ Italy, and Germany have heavily‌ invested in this project, ‍resulting in innovative engineering ‍practices and cutting-edge technological advancements.

Current Achievements and Future‍ Prospects

According to recent reports from ITER management, the completion ⁤marks over 70% progress toward assembling ‌critical components needed for operational experiments slated​ to‍ commence within several years. This ‍accomplishment underscores not only technical expertise but also highlights significant international cooperation⁤ aimed at global energy sustainability.

Real-World Implications of Nuclear Fusion Energy⁢

Nuclear fusion promises ⁤a virtually limitless source of clean energy—producing ‍minimal greenhouse gases compared⁤ to‌ fossil fuels—and lower ⁣radioactive waste than current fission reactors. With successful operations ⁤at facilities like ITER⁣ expected by 2035 or sooner based⁤ on ongoing improvements across various sectors tied into this project’s ⁣framework, scientists remain hopeful about breakthroughs that may change energy consumption patterns globally.

Europe’s commitment through significant advances with its vacuum vessel assembly suggests monumental strides towards realizing functional fusion power⁢ generation capabilities through collaborations ⁣initiated under international frameworks ​like those⁣ surrounding ITER.
